Nearby Coastal Areas
For beach lovers and outdoor enthusiasts, the coastal villages of Gnarabup, Smiths Beach, and Prevelly are perfect. These areas provide stunning ocean views, surf opportunities, and relaxing holiday rentals right by the sea. Many properties here have direct access to beaches and walking trails, making it easy to enjoy activities like swimming, surfing, and coastal walks.

Activities and Things to Do in Margaret River
Margaret River is not just about relaxing in your holiday rental — it’s about immersing yourself in memorable activities that highlight its natural beauty and local culture. To enhance your family-oriented, experience-focused holiday, explore some of the must-do activities and local experiences:
- Wine Tasting and Vineyard Tours: Discover world-class wineries in the region, many offering guided tastings and cellar door experiences. Many vineyards also have on-site restaurants serving delicious local cuisine.
- Surfing and Beach Activities: From beginner-friendly waves to expert surf spots, the beaches around Margaret River are perfect for surfing, paddleboarding, and beachcombing.
- Wildlife Encounters and Nature Walks: Take guided tours in the national parks or visit wildlife sanctuaries to see kangaroos, koalas, and rare bird species. The Cape to Cape Track offers stunning coastal views for keen hikers.
- Local Markets and Festivals: Experience local flavor by visiting farmers markets, craft fairs, and seasonal festivals that often showcase local artisans, food producers, and performers.
- Gourmet Food Experiences: Indulge in fresh seafood, locally sourced produce, and artisanal products at the region’s many farm gates, cafes, and fine dining establishments.
- Arts, Culture, and Indigenous Heritage: Engage with local art galleries, cultural centers, and indigenous heritage sites that tell the story of the land and its traditional custodians.
